- The purpose of this announcement is to provide an update on the Department of Homeland Security, Domestic Nuclear Detection Office (DNDO) Human Portable Tripwire (HPT) program. On October 27, 2011, DNDO hosted an Industry Day to present the draft Operational Requirements and Concept of Operations for a HPT device. Following the Industry Day, one-on-one meetings were held with interested vendors to review the capabilities of currently available commercial products and proposed prototype devices and to receive industry feedback on the HPT draft Operational Requirements. On February 3, 2012, DNDO hosted a conference call with the vendors that participated in the one-on-one meetings, to announce that DNDO had approved the HPT Program Office proceeding with the next phase of the program. This phase will include updating the HPT Analysis of Alternatives (AoA) and Operational Requirements Document (ORD) in coordination with CBP, USCG, TSA and State/Local Organizations. DNDO's AoA effort will focus on refining the 10 operational scenarios in the current AoA, to better define where HPT systems can potentially improve rad/nuc detection, identification and adjudication. The AoA will also incorporate industry feedback on the draft HPT requirements, provided by the vendors at the above referenced one-on-one meetings. The information presented in the February 3, 2012 conference call is available to interested parties upon request. Additionally, the HPT Program will conduct another program update to industry via conference call at the end of April.
